From an article about a Vermont bookstore that's offering to purge customer records in order to prevent them from being collected under the Patriot Act: "Peggy Bresee was in Bear Pond Books recently to buy War is a Force That Gives Us Meaning and The Best Democracy Money Can Buy as birthday gifts for a son who lives in Utah. She had the store purge the purchase records. 'It really does make me feel so much better,' she said. 'They're protecting those of us who are readers. It matters.'"
